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Station Facilities at Ince & Elton (Cheshire)

Ince & Elton (Cheshire) station offers the basic necessities for commuters and travelers, ensuring a straightforward and hassle-free experience. However, it's important to highlight that the station does not have a ticket office or machines for purchasing or collecting tickets. Travelers are encouraged to purchase their tickets online in advance.

Accessibility is a partial focus at the station. There is step-free access to certain parts, including level access from the car park to the Helsby platform and a safe foot crossing to the Ellesmere Port platform. For those requiring assistance, the conductor can aid upon train arrival; no booking is necessary though it's appreciated. Unfortunately, there are no waiting rooms, accessible toilets, or refreshment facilities on-site. Parking is available with 10 free spaces, ensuring convenience for drivers.

Onward Travel Options

Though modest in its offerings, Ince & Elton (Cheshire) connects to various modes of transport. Rail replacement services are conveniently located at the Station Road stops, ensuring easy transitions between train and bus should the need arise. Taxis can be arranged through local services, and the Northern Railway cab4you service provides further support for getting around. While bicycle hire isn't available directly at the station, local options exist for this eco-friendly transport method.

Rhyl Station Facilities

Rhyl Train Station is well-equipped with facilities to ensure a pleasant travel experience. Ticket purchasing is straightforward with the station's well-staffed ticket office operating from early morning until late in the evening. You’ll find convenient ticket machines which accept both cash and cards, offering accessible options for all travelers. It's reassuring to note that you can collect tickets bought online directly from these machines.

Concerned about accessibility? Rhyl Station is designed with step-free access, featuring facilities that cater to everyone’s needs. Take advantage of accessible ticket machines, induction loops, and staff assistance available throughout the week. Public conveniences such as accessible toilets and baby changing facilities are located on Platform 1. Additionally, the station provides free Wi-Fi, making it easy to stay connected.

Onward Travel

Satisfaction doesn’t stop at the station with a host of onward travel options available. Bus connections are conveniently accessed just outside the station with the option of purchasing a PlusBus ticket for unlimited travel within the area, offering exceptional value. Despite the absence of a dedicated cycle hire facility, ample bicycle storage is available, should you prefer to explore the town on two wheels. For those who might need rail replacement services, they can find them at Bay 6, ensuring continued travel even through disruptions.
